Ice Sculpture Trail in Norwich

The 2009 Ice Sculpture Trail - is unveiled the last Sunday before Christmas, Sunday 20th December. It commences at John Lewis, Ber Street and this year's theme is Norwich at play. The sculptures are created from approximately 10 tonnes of ice and are hand-carved by a team of five over 3 months in London. They are sculpted in the Samurai tradition with Japanese tools and then delivered to Norwich at minus 25C.

This year find out who Mr Pastry was, and what rock hero played in the city. Watch live carving at The Whiffler outdoor theatre and follow the trail full of stories and memories through the heart of Norwich from Ber Street to Norwich Castle Gardens.
